A rachet consists of a round equipment or a linear rack with pearly whites, and a pivoting, spring-loaded finger known as a pawl that engages one’s teeth. The teeth happen to be uniform but asymmetrical, with each tooth having a moderate slope using one edge and a much steeper slope on the various other edge.

When one’s teeth are Ratchets Wheel relocating the unrestricted (i.e. forward) route, the pawl quickly slides up and over the delicately sloped edges of one’s teeth, with a early spring forcing it (quite often with an audible ‘click’) into the depression between your teeth as it passes the suggestion of each tooth. When one’s teeth move in the contrary (backward) direction, even so, the pawl will capture against the steeply sloped edge of the 1st tooth it encounters, thereby locking it against the tooth and protecting against any further motion for the reason that direction.

Backlash
Because the ratchet can only just stop backward motion at discrete details (i.e., at tooth boundaries), a ratchet does let a restricted amount of backward movement. This backward motion-which is limited to a maximum range add up to the spacing between your teeth-is called backlash. Where backlash should be minimized, a simple, toothless ratchet with a high friction surface such as rubber may also be employed. The pawl bears against the surface at an angle in order that any backward motion may cause the pawls for ratchets wheel58472990651pawl to jam against the surface and hence prevent any further backward motion. Because the backward travel length is mostly a function of the compressibility of the huge friction surface, this device can result in significantly reduced backlash.
